User Experience (UX) Researcher

AppFolio is looking for a User Experience Researcher to join our fast paced, hungry team working to bring the power of well-designed SaaS products to a multitude of vertical industries.  

The UX Researcher provides day-to-day team support for product development while also driving large strategic research projects. Research work includes generative, formative and evaluative studies. They are responsible for inspiring user-centered design through exposure to user insights and facilitation of collaborative design activities.  A tireless advocate for the customer, this individual frames qualitative and quantitative behavioral data into compelling stories to establish user empathy on the team.


The ideal candidate will be an excellent communicator, knowledgeable and eager to apply Agile and Lean UX techniques, comfortable in a fast moving organization, excited to collaborate with Software Engineers, QA Engineers, UX Designers, and Product Managers to build revolutionary software solutions.


You will work with minimal direction to quickly deliver high-quality outputs. There will be overlapping projects, so you are good at multi-tasking, juggling competing priorities, and organizing yourself.

Responsibilities:

  • Support and engage product development teams in user research activities during problem discovery, including facilitation of LeanUX-inspired activities that promote design thinking and alignment on the team.
  • Work closely with product and design teams to identify research questions, build a research plan that will answer them, and communicate the insights to shape the user experiences of AppFolio Property Manager
  • Conduct research that maps our users’ latent needs to new strategic initiatives and opportunities for product innovation.
  • Translate qualitative and quantitative data into compelling stories to build enduring empathetic connections between AppFolio employees and our Customers
  • Provide rich context for both product and research backlogs that helps inform prioritization and aligns with the overall business strategy
  • Actively participate in the evolving UX team strategy, discovering and piloting new tools and resources that promote agile and lean methodologies

Knowledge and Skills:

  • Strong technical aptitude, product common sense, and curiosity combined with a genuine love for products, people, and user experience
  • Solid experience in gathering user and business data to inform and quantify a UX strategy
  • Ability to identify and utilize the best method or mix of methods based on research questions, timeline and resourcing
  • Proven ability to break complex customer requests down to the core problem and propose innovative solutions
  • Knowledge of Agile UX and Lean UX methodologies and experience working in a highly collaborative, agile environment is a huge plus
  • A fundamental knowledge of UX Design, best practices, and experience designing wireframes or prototypes for research validation
  • Minimum of 3 years experience in user experience, research, or business analysis.  BA in Human Factors, cognitive psychology, or related field is preferred
